编程直播讲什么内容好

worktile 其他 7

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程直播可以讲授多种内容,以下是几个比较受欢迎的建议。

    1. 编程语言介绍和基础知识:可以选择一种常用的编程语言,如Python、Java或JavaScript,讲解其基础语法、数据类型、变量和函数等概念,帮助初学者打下扎实的编程基础。

    2. 常见编程问题解决方法:分享一些常见的编程问题,如数组排序、字符串处理或数据结构的使用等,分析问题背后的逻辑和解决方法,帮助学习者培养解决问题的能力。

    3. 前端开发技术:可以讲解HTML、CSS和JavaScript等前端开发技术,介绍网页布局、样式设计、交互效果等,还可以分享一些常见的前端框架和工具,如Vue.js或React等。

    4. 后端开发技术:介绍后端开发技术,如数据库操作、API设计、服务器部署等。可以选择一种流行的后端语言和框架,如Node.js或Django,讲解其使用方法和开发流程。

    5. 数据科学和机器学习:讲解一些数据科学和机器学习的基础知识,如数据预处理、特征工程、模型训练和评估等。可以使用Python的数据科学库,如NumPy、Pandas和Scikit-learn等进行案例演示。

    6. 编码规范和工程实践:介绍一些编码规范和工程实践的重要性,如代码可读性、模块化设计、版本控制等。可以分享一些实际项目中遇到的问题和解决方法。

    7. 编程项目实战:选择一个有趣的编程项目,通过实践的方式讲解项目的开发过程和关键技术。可以是一个简单的Web应用、游戏开发或数据分析等。

    以上只是一些建议,具体的内容可以根据自己的专长和受众需求进行选择。最重要的是能够对受众的需求提供有价值的内容,并通过直播形式生动地进行讲解和演示。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程直播可以涵盖众多内容,取决于你的兴趣和专长。以下是一些可能的编程直播内容建议:

    1. 编程语言入门教程:讲解各种编程语言的基础知识和语法规则,如Python、Java、C++等。适合初学者,帮助他们打好编程基础。

    2. 算法与数据结构讲解:深入讲解各种常见的算法和数据结构,如排序算法、查找算法、链表、树等。通过实例和代码演示,帮助学习者理解和掌握这些重要的计算机科学概念。

    3. Web 开发教程:介绍如何使用各种常见的前端和后端技术来构建网站和 Web 应用程序。包括 HTML、CSS、JavaScript、Node.js、React等技术的讲解和实战项目演示。

    4. 数据科学与机器学习:讲解数据科学和机器学习的基础知识和算法,如数据清洗、特征工程、回归、分类、聚类等。同时可以通过案例分析和实际操作,帮助学习者掌握数据分析和机器学习的实际应用。

    5. 游戏开发教程:介绍如何使用游戏引擎(如Unity)和编程语言(如C#)来制作游戏。从游戏设计到实际开发和测试,引导学习者完成自己的游戏项目。

    在直播过程中,可以通过讲解、演示和实际编程操作等多种方式,配合互动和答疑环节,提高学习效果。此外,注意直播的流畅性和质量,确保音视频清晰稳定,以提供更好的观看体验。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程直播可以讲授各种编程语言、框架和技术的基础知识和实操技巧。下面是一些可能的内容:

    1. 编程语言入门
    • 基础概念和语法
    • 变量和数据类型
    • 条件语句和循环
    • 函数和模块
    • 输入输出和文件操作
    1. 前端开发
    • HTML 和 CSS 基础
    • JavaScript 基础和DOM 操作
    • 常用的前端框架(例如React或Vue.js)
    • 响应式设计和布局
    1. 后端开发
    • 常用的后端语言(例如Python、Java或Node.js)
    • 数据库基础(例如SQL语法和数据建模)
    • RESTful API 设计和开发
    • 鉴权和安全性
    1. 数据科学与机器学习
    • 数据清洗和数据探索
    • 常用数据科学库(例如Numpy、Pandas和Matplotlib)
    • 机器学习算法和模型训练
    • 深度学习框架(例如TensorFlow或PyTorch)
    1. 软件工程和项目管理
    • 版本控制(例如Git)
    • 单元测试和集成测试
    • 敏捷开发和Scrum方法论
    • 项目管理工具(例如Jira或Trello)
    1. 其他领域(例如游戏开发、移动应用开发或物联网)
    • 游戏开发引擎(例如Unity或Unreal Engine)
    • 移动应用开发框架(例如Android开发或iOS开发)
    • 物联网技术和传感器应用

    除了以上内容,还可以针对特定主题进行直播,例如编写算法、解决实际问题的案例分析、编程技巧和最佳实践等。在直播过程中,可以结合代码演示、实例讲解、问题答疑和互动交流等方式来进行教学。为了提高学习效果,可以配套提供课件、示例代码和练习题等讲义资料。同时,鼓励学习者参与互动,提问和解答问题,将直播变得更加生动和实用。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部